Nairobi (NBO) to Ukunda (UKA) Flight Distance
The flight distance from Jomo Kenyatta International Airport (NBO) in Nairobi, Kenya to Ukunda Airstrip (UKA) in Ukunda, Kenya is 442 kilometers (274 miles / 238 nautical miles). The estimated flight time for this route is approximately 2h, flying southeast at a heading of 138°.
